Françoise GARNIER (GRENIER) was born 13 May 1719 in Neuville, Portneuf, Canada, New France
Françoise GARNIER (GRENIER) was the child of Claude GARNIER (GRENIER) and Madeleine COQUIN dite LATOURELLE and the grandchild of: (paternal) Jean GARNIER and Madeleine LEGUAY (maternal) Pierre-Jean COQUIN dit LATOURELLE and Catherine BEAUDINSpouse(s)/Partner(s) and Child(ren):
Françoise married Jean-Baptiste GINGRAS 4 September 1741 in Neuville, Portneuf, Canada, New France . The couple had (at least) 1 child.
Jean-Baptiste GINGRAS was born 11 April 1716 in Neuville, Portneuf, Québec, Canada (Saint-François-de-Sales). Jean-Baptiste died 31 March 1781 in Neuville, Portneuf, Québec, Canada (Saint-François-de-Sales). Jean-Baptiste was the child of Jean-Baptiste GINGRAS and Marie-Madeleine LEFEBVRE dite ANGERS.
Françoise GARNIER (GRENIER) died 27 July 1803 in Neuville, Portneuf, Lower Canada .

From its inception in the early 1600s until 1760, it was called Canada, New France.
1760 to 1763, it was simply Canada
1763 to 1791 - Province of Québec
1791 to 1867 - Lower Canada
1867 to present - Québec, Canada.
